Do you think that it will depreciate faster than a C2S? Seems like the production numbers will be 2 coupe and 2 cab per dealer. And only for 1 year. I don't know how many dealers there are but it seems that production numbers will be low and most of the C2S crowd has been envious of the wider hips. Any chance this car will retain value better than a C2S?
1) The buyer will NOT get the larger discount as seen with the C2S on this more exclusive car.
2) 2011 c2S cars in general will take the biggest hit if the new 991 is launched in 2012 .
Think about it -
Who is going to pay near 110K for a used GtS when he can get a new 991 the next year ? Or 90 K for GTS two years later? Especially when he can buy an 09 used in the 60's by then?
Even a Turbo won't depreciate this way . When the 991 comes out the Turbo production will either cease for a year hiatus or they will clear out 997tt parts and extend production.
even a Gt3 RS won't depreciate this way . It's a special track car and the last dry sump traditional Porsche.
In my opinion the GtS will be the freefalling new Porsche value .
Just like the anniversary edition 996 fell . Just like the Cayenne GtS fell. Both were great cars and so will the GtS be -- but the buyer might risk a huge expense.
